Radnor Lake's Jr. Ranger Intern Program 2014 (Session 1)
Radnor Lake had it’s first week of the Jr. Ranger Intern Program at Radnor Lake. Session 1 started on Monday, June 23rd and ended on Saturday, June 28th.
The Junior Ranger Intern Program is funded by Friends of Radnor Lake which includes 5 days of trail work with State Park Rangers along the trail system at the natural area.
On Thursday, June 27th the Jr. Ranger Interns, Radnor Lake Staff and Friends of Radnor Lake volunteers conducted a 10-mile river clean up along the Buffalo River in Flatwoods, TN. Among the clean-up were 24 tires which were recycled thru the Bridgestone Tire Recycling Program which was recently received a Governer’s Stewardship Award on June 23rd by TDEC.
In addition, the Jr. Ranger Interns and Radnor Lake Staff worked with two volunteer groups to conclude this weeks session:
Nissan Volunteers on Friday afternoon, June 27th along the Lake Trail hauling gravel and mulch.
Park volunteers on Saturday morning, June 28th along the Lake Trail and South Lake Trails hauling gravel, mulch and installing fencing to improve the current trail system at Radnor Lake.
